[08-12-2022] Mendocino County, CA - Three Injured After Head-on Collision near Pratt Place Resulting in Suspected DUIThree people were hurt after a head-on collision near Pratt Place on August 12.

The accident occurred on Friday along U.S. 101 close to Dora Creek.

Rebeckah K., age 41, and three unidentified young girls, ages 17, 15, and 10, were among the other four passengers.

A 15-year-old girl suffered severe injuries from the collision, while Kencke only had moderate injuries. They took them to different hospitals to receive medical attention for their wounds.

According to the California Highway Patrol, Tyson Y., 41, was operating his Toyota Tundra southbound on the highway when he veered into the northbound lane.

Young crossed the road and struck Kencke’s Kia Sedona head-on. Kencke was operating the vehicle.

Young was taken to the hospital after the collision and sustained severe injuries.

Young was arrested for felony DUI after discovering that he was intoxicated at the crash.

Head-on Collision Accident Statistics

Another accident that can cause severe injuries is a head-on collision. This is because head-on collisions, which have the most force, happen when two moving cars collide. Victims frequently sustain head injuries from slamming inside the car or crashing through the windshield.

2% of accidents are head-on collisions, but they cause more than 10% of traffic fatalities.

These collisions are partly caused by mechanical failure, driver fatigue, drunk driving, and distracted driving.

More than 90% of traffic accidents result from human error, such as reckless driving. Over 13,000 more people die due to reckless driving each year, accounting for 33% of all fatalities in significant auto accidents.

Head-on collision accidents have the potential to result in severe injury or death. A lot of energy is released in head-on collisions. Because of the higher power, fatalities in this kind of accident are more likely.
